Find s(t), where s(t) represents the position function, v(t) represents the velocity function, and a(t) represents the acceleration function. a(t)=−18t+8, with v(0)=1 and s(0)=7 s(t) = ___

Answers

The s(t) position function, we need to integrate the acceleration function a(t) = -18t + 8 twice with respect to t and apply the initial conditions v(0) = 1 and s(0) = 7.

Given the acceleration function a(t) = -18t + 8, we need to find the position function s(t) by integrating the acceleration function twice.

We integrate a(t) with respect to t to find the velocity function v(t):

v(t) = ∫ a(t) dt = ∫ (-18t + 8) dt = -9t^2 + 8t + C1.

We apply the initial condition v(0) = 1 to determine the constant C1:

v(0) = -9(0)^2 + 8(0) + C1 = C1 = 1.

The velocity function becomes:

v(t) = -9t^2 + 8t + 1.

We integrate v(t) with respect to t to find the position function s(t):

s(t) = ∫ v(t) dt = ∫ (-9t^2 + 8t + 1) dt = -3t^3 + 4t^2 + t + C2.

We apply the initial condition s(0) = 7 to determine the constant C2:

s(0) = -3(0)^3 + 4(0)^2 + 0 + C2 = C2 = 7.

The position function is:

s(t) = -3t^3 + 4t^2 + t + 7.

Hence, the position function s(t) represents the particle's position at time t.

A grocery store purchases cantaloupes from two warehouses, A and B. The
distribution of the diameters from Warehouse A is approximately normal with a
mean of 120 mm and standard deviation of 6 mm.
(a) For a cantaloupe selected at random from Warehouse A, what is the
probability that the cantaloupe will have a diameter greater than 127 mm?
A randomly selected cantaloupe from Warehouse B has the probability of 0.763
that it will have a diameter greater than 127 mm. The grocery store purchases
40% of their cantaloupes from Warehouse B.
(b) For a cantaloupe selected at random from the grocery store, what is the
probability that the cantaloupe will have a diameter greater than 127 mm?
(c) If the randomly selected cantaloupe's diameter is greater than 127 mm, what
is the probability the cantaloupe came from Warehouse B?

Answers

A: The probability of cantaloupe having dia. more than 127 is 0.12167.

B: Cantaloupe selected at random from the warehouse, then the probability that has a diameter of more than 127 mm is 0.3782.

C: The probability that the cantaloupe will be from warehouse B given randomly selected cantaloupe's diameter is greater than 127 mm, is 0.8069.

What is probability?

The probability formula is defined as the possibility of an event happening being equal to the ratio of the number of favorable outcomes and the total number of outcomes. Probability is a measure of the likelihood of an event occurring.  Also, the favorable number of outcomes cannot be negative.

Given two warehouses, A and B

mean for warehouse A = μ = 120 mm

The standard deviation for warehouse A = σ = 6mm

A:  a cantaloupe selected at random from Warehouse A

to find the probability of cantaloupe having a diameter greater than      127 mm = P(x > 127)

P(x > 127) = 1 - P(x ≤ 127)

P(x ≤ 127) = P((x - μ)/σ)

P(x ≤ 127) = P((127 - 120)/6)

P(x ≤ 127) = P(z ≤ 1.66)

P(x ≤ 127) = 0.87833

P(x > 127) = 1 - P(x ≤ 127)

P(x > 127) = 1 - P(x < 127) = 0.12167

probability of cantaloupe having dia. more than 127 is 0.12167.

B: Let event A for distributor A and  let event B for distributor B

and event C for a diameter greater than 127 mm.

and given A randomly selected cantaloupe from Warehouse B has a probability of 0.763 that it will have a diameter greater than 127 mm,

and the percentage of cantaloupe provided by B is 40%

rest 60% for A,

therefore, for cantaloupe selected at random, the probability of having a diameter greater than 127 mm is

P(C) = P(C|A)P(A) + P(C|B)P(B)

=  0.12167(0.6) + 0.763(0.4)

= 0.073 + 0.3052

P(C) = 0.3782

cantaloupe selected at random from the warehouse, then the probability that has a diameter of more than 127 mm is 0.3782.

C:   the probability the cantaloupe came from Warehouse B, given that the randomly selected cantaloupe's diameter is greater than 127 mm,

P(B|C) = P(B ∩ C)/P(C)

P(B|C) = (P(C|B)P(B))/P(C)

substitute values

P(B|C) = ((0.763)(0.4))/0.3782

P(B|C) = 0.3052/0.3782

P(B|C) = 0.8069

The probability that the cantaloupe will be from warehouse B given randomly selected cantaloupe's diameter is greater than 127 mm, is 0.8069.

Hence the probabilities are,

A;  0.12167

B; 0.3782

C; 0.8069.

Two angles form a linear pair. The measure of one angle is x and the measure of the other angle is 1.4 times x plus 12∘ . Find the measure of each angle.

Answers

Answer:

70° and 110°

Step-by-step explanation:

If two angles forms a linear pair, this means that the sum of the angles is 180°. If the measure of one angle is x and the measure of the other angle is 1.4 times x plus 12∘

Let A be the first angle = x°

Let B be the second angle = (1.4x+12)°

Since they form a linear pair, then

A+B = 180°

x + 1.4x+12 = 180°

2.4x = 180-12

2.4x = 168

x = 168/2.4

x = 70°

The measure of angle A = 70°

The measure if angle B = 1.4x+12

B = 1.4(70)+12

B = 98+12

B = 110°

The measure of both angles are 70° and 110°

9. Name the four basic logic gates.

Answers

The four basic logic gates are AND, OR, NOT, and XOR.

1. AND Gate: This gate takes two or more inputs and produces an output of 1 (true) only if all the inputs are 1 (true).
2. OR Gate: This gate takes two or more inputs and produces an output of 1 (true) if at least one of the inputs is 1 (true).
3. NOT Gate (Inverter): This gate has only one input and inverts it, producing an output of 1 (true) if the input is 0 (false) and vice versa.
4. XOR Gate (Exclusive OR): This gate takes two inputs and produces an output of 1 (true) if either, but not both, of the inputs are 1 (true).

the length of each side of a square is 3 inches more than the length of each side of a smaller square. the sum of the areas of the squares is 149 inches squared. find the length of the side of the smaller square.

Answers

The length of the side of the smaller square is 7 inches.

Let x be the length of the side of the smaller square.

The length of each side of a square is 3 inches more than the length of each side of a smaller square. Thus the length of the side of the larger square is

(x + 3) inches.

The area of the smaller square is

x^2 square inches.

The area of the larger square is

(x + 3)^2 square inches.

We can set up the equation:

x^2 + (x + 3)^2 = 149

Expanding and simplifying the equation gives:

x^2 + x^2 + 6x + 9 = 149

Combining like terms:

2x^2 + 6x - 140 = 0

Using the quadratic formula, we can solve for x:

x = (-b ± √(b^2 - 4ac)) / 2a

x = (-6 ± √(6^2 - 4 * 2 * (-140))) / 2 * 2

x = (-6 ± √(36 + 1120)) / 4

x = (-6 ± √(1156)) / 4

x = (-6 ± √(596)) / 4

x = (-6 ± 34) / 4

x = -10 or x = 7

The side length of the smaller square can't be negative, so x = 7 inches.
